…invalid voltage value (#10231) - Why I did it Fix issue: psu might use wrong voltage sysfs which causes invalid voltage value. The flow is like: 1. User power off a PSU 2. All sysfs files related to this PSU are removed 3. User did a reboot/config reload 4. PSU will use wrong sysfs as voltage node - How I did it Always try find an existing sysfs. - How to verify it Manual test
